ABC pulls Jimmy Kimmel off the air 'indefinitely' over his Charlie Kirk comments after FCC chair's threats

1. ABC suspends Jimmy Kimmel's show indefinitely over controversial comments. 2. FCC chair Brendan Carr condemned Kimmel's remarks, warning about affiliate licenses. 3. Nexstar, an ABC affiliate owner, is replacing Kimmel's show with alternate programming. 4. Kimmel's suspension reflects broader tensions in media over public discourse. 5. Nexstar is seeking FCC approval for a $6.2 billion acquisition, influencing programming decisions.
